Supplies You'll Need

  • Gel polish base coat
  • Gel polish top coat
  • Acrylic paints (various floral colors)
  • Fine detail nail art brushes
  • Dotting tool
  • LED/UV lamp

How To Recreate It

  1. Apply a base coat and cure under an LED/UV lamp.
  2. Apply 2 coats of pastel pink gel polish and cure after each coat.
  3. Using fine detail brushes and acrylic paints, paint realistic floral designs onto each nail. Start with larger shapes and layer details.
  4. Use a dotting tool to add small dots for floral accents.
  5. Allow the acrylic paint to dry completely.
  6. Apply a glossy top coat and cure under the lamp.

Expert Tip

Use a light hand and build up the color gradually for the most realistic effect. Practice your floral painting on a nail art practice sheet before applying to your nails.

Common Issues & Fixes

  • Acrylic paint smudging?
    Allow the acrylic paint to dry completely before applying the top coat. Use thin layers of paint.
  • Gel polish not curing properly?
    Ensure your LED/UV lamp is functioning correctly and cure for the recommended time.
  • Uneven floral designs?
    Practice your floral painting on a practice sheet first. Use a light hand and build up color gradually.
  • Bubbles in the top coat?
    Apply the top coat in thin, even layers. Avoid shaking the bottle vigorously.

FAQs

How long will this design last?

With proper care, this design can last up to 2-3 weeks.

Can I use regular nail polish instead of gel polish?

While possible, gel polish provides a longer-lasting and more durable base for the acrylic paint.

What type of acrylic paint is best for nail art?

High-quality acrylic paints specifically designed for nail art are recommended for the best results.

How do I clean my nail art brushes?

Clean your brushes with water or brush cleaner immediately after use to prevent the paint from drying and damaging the bristles.

Is this design suitable for short nails?

While possible, the intricate details are best showcased on medium to long nails.

Can I simplify the design?

Yes, you can opt for simpler floral patterns or fewer flowers to make the design more manageable.
